keyDownHandler(event) {
var _a;
const root = this.el.closest("calcite-tree:not([child])");
const target = event.target;
if (root === this.el && target.tagName === "CALCITE-TREE-ITEM" && this.el.contains(target)) {
switch (event.key) {
case "ArrowDown":
const next = target.nextElementSibling;
if (next && next.matches("calcite-tree-item")) {
next.focus();
event.preventDefault();
}
break;
case "ArrowLeft":
// When focus is on an open node, closes the node.
if (target.hasChildren && target.expanded) {
target.expanded = false;
event.preventDefault();
break;
}
// When focus is on a child node that is also either an end node or a closed node, moves focus to its parent node.
const parentItem = target.parentElement.closest("calcite-tree-item");
if (parentItem && (!target.hasChildren || target.expanded === false)) {
parentItem.focus();
event.preventDefault();
break;
}
// When focus is on a root node that is also either an end node or a closed node, does nothing.
break;
case "ArrowRight":
if (!target.hasChildren) {
break;
}
if (target.expanded && document.activeElement === target) {
// When focus is on an open node, moves focus to the first child node.
(_a = target.querySelector("calcite-tree-item")) === null || _a === void 0 ? void 0 : _a.focus();
event.preventDefault();
}
else {
// When focus is on a closed node, opens the node; focus does not move.
target.expanded = true;
event.preventDefault();
}
// When focus is on an end node, does nothing.
break;
case "ArrowUp":
const previous = target.previousElementSibling;
if (previous && previous.matches("calcite-tree-item")) {
previous.focus();
event.preventDefault();
}
break;
}
}
}
updateAncestorTree(e) {
const item = e.target;
const children = item.querySelectorAll("calcite-tree-item");
const ancestors = [];
let parent = item.parentElement.closest("calcite-tree-item");
while (parent) {
ancestors.push(parent);
parent = parent.parentElement.closest("calcite-tree-item");
}
item.selected = !item.selected;
item.indeterminate = false;
if (children === null || children === void 0 ? void 0 : children.length) {
children.forEach((el) => {
el.selected = item.selected;
el.indeterminate = false;
});
}
if (ancestors) {
ancestors.forEach((ancestor) => {
const descendants = nodeListToArray(ancestor.querySelectorAll("calcite-tree-item"));
const activeDescendants = descendants.filter((el) => el.selected);
if (activeDescendants.length === 0) {
ancestor.selected = false;
ancestor.indeterminate = false;
return;
}
const indeterminate = activeDescendants.length < descendants.length;
ancestor.indeterminate = indeterminate;
ancestor.selected = !indeterminate;
});
}
this.calciteTreeSelect.emit({
selected: nodeListToArray(this.el.querySelectorAll("calcite-tree-item")).filter((i) => i.selected)
});
}
